Key facts
- U.S. crude oil futures for May delivery jumped more than 8% to above $100 per barrel, and International benchmark Brent for June delivery also advanced over 8% in early trade
- Asia-Pacific markets traded lower Monday, with India's Nifty 50 the worst-performing major Asian index, declining nearly 2%
- Meanwhile, President Donald Trump on Sunday bashed Pope Leo XIV over the U.S.-born Roman Catholic pontiff's criticism of the U.S. war in Iran
- U.S. Central Command said Sunday the military will blockade all maritime traffic entering and exiting Iranian ports on Monday at 10 a.m
